Dec 21, 2018 - Baking a ham on a gas grill is no more difficult or complicated than baking one in your oven, and it has the advantages of freeing your oven for other use, adding smoke flavor and _not_ heating up your kitchen. In this configuration, coals burn slowly in two rows on either side of the grill, with a water pan in the center to provide a moist environment and help stabilize temperatures.
